It seems like everyday there is new public allegation or harrowing tale of sexual assault, and that has got some people (mostly men) crying "Fascism!!" and calling for the heads of so-called 'feminazis'. There are, however, a few key differences in a society that prioritizes human equality while enforcing punishments for those that commit acts of sexual violence and a full-blown fascist regime. They ladies understand this can be a confusing issue for some men, so this episode is the first in a series of sex worker stories from Nazi Germany in an effort to educate, enlighten and (hopefully) entertain everyone!
